LAS VEGAS (KSNV MyNews3) – The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department is searching for a man suspected of a bank robbery in the area of West Lake Mead and North Rampart boulevards.
Metro says the suspect approached a teller just after 1:30 p.m. New Year’s Eve and presented a note demanding money. The teller complied, and the suspect fled out the main entrance.
The suspect is described as a white male, between 30 and 40 years old, 6-foot-3 and 170 pounds. He was last seen wearing a gray, trucker-type cap, dark sunglasses, a dark hoodie, white T-shirt, slim blue jeans and dark Converse tennis shoes with white trim.
